Hello all

I have made the error of ordering 500 XL blade 1.5 mm crimps. Question is can I nip 1mm off the end of the crimp to shorten them to use.

In theory it should be fine just want to make sure I am not overlooking any issues further down the line.

The crimp will still be made the same and structurally sound just need to shorten the XL blade to a L with a sip.

Thanks all.
 
If I’m understanding you correct, this is a red flat blade crimp, if so I see no probs in cutting a mm of the flat blade length, done it many times, important thing is that you are using ratchet crimpers and not a cheap set of so called crimping pliers that you get for £1.99.
